Restaurant Exposure: THIS RESTAURANT BRIBES CUSTOMERS FOR 5 STAR RATINGS BY PROVIDING FREE GIFTS IN RETURN FOR A 5 ⭐. RATINGS ARE NOT 100% RELIABLE. READ REVIEWS BEFOREHAND, READ REVIEWS THAT GO BEYOND A FEW SENTENCES, AND PROCEED WITH CAUTION. A laminated card encouraging people to provide a 5 star rating is provided to customers upon sitting down, however it was (perhaps deliberately?) all written in only Chinese. I take my Google Local Guide review writing seriously and will expose all businesses that do this bullcrap nonsense as it ruins the integrity of the review & rating system that many rely on. That being said, this review is 100% my own and I did not receive ANY rewards for this review. ------------- I had their curry laksa/mee, and while it's presentation was very nice and enticing, the siham/blood cockles were both not fresh and also overcooked. Curry laksa/mee soup was flavorful but was too little for the amount of noodles, so over time as you eat, the noodles will keep absorbing the broth and a bowl of soupy noodles turns into dry noodles. This was my biggest qualm about it but otherwise there is plenty of toppings & ingredients in the bowl and it's a well-prepared bowl of curry mee, that just has plenty of room for improvement. I also had the Cham C and Lorbak. They were both pretty average only. In hindsight, their food was mediocre. Not inedible, just mediocre. Has plenty of room for improvement, but I can say that their dining environment is comfortable and clean and well lit, and their staff's service is good and they were very attentive to our needs. They also have a cute resident cafe cat that is extremely fluffy and goes around the restaurant if it's awake. Overall, decent neighborhood place to get your every-day meal. But is it worthy of it's high ratings? Probably not—because of their bribery/rewards system for people who give them 5 stars. If you want 5 stars, you have to earn it. Improve your food, improve your menu based on real feedback. Not fake your way through it.

A little hidden from the main Puchong area, but using Waze/Google map, it should bring u there easily. Located in one of the shoplot with ample parking space infront. Nice and cosy setup inside. Tried out their signature Hokkien Prawn Mee and Curry Mee + 2 white coffee, total (+tax) RM42+... Thumbs up 👍🏻 for their Hokkien Prawn Noodle - broth is flavourful, tasty, with a good portion of noodle served; unlike some places. Curry just okay... for me personally, I find it not creamy enough. Noodle portion good, too. 👍🏻 Their white coffee is the best. Creamy and foamy, taste good!

First time visit today after saw decent review. Came in morning 11am but nasi lemak fried chicken already sold out. So settled for curry chicken. Was informed later fragrance rice also no more and will swap with plain white rice. I reluctantly accepted. When served the chicken was cold. All breast parts. Anchovies not fresh and hard. Biggest sin for nasi lemak. No sambal given. Everything was bland. plain white rice with no sambal and non edible anchovies. For the price of 16.90 before tax I expect cafe quality nasi lemak. The only saving grace was the coffee is decent.
